That's nice for a start - but you need at least two more things:
- GPS tracklog
- accelerometer/orientation tracklog
THEN you would not only know what the camera was looking at, but from where (GPS) and from what viewing angle/direction (orientation).
In theory it would allow you to post-process logs from multiple officers into a virtual-scene.
PLUS you need to have legislation which guarantees people the right to view the logs and imposes massive fines and other penalties for "oops, we seem to have lost that footage" probably including an immediate dismissal of any case.
